APPARATUS AND METHOD OF UPLINK BEAMFORMING IN WIRELESS LOCAL AREA NETWORK SYSTEM - A simplified explanation of the abstract

This abstract first appeared for US patent application 20240030974 titled 'APPARATUS AND METHOD OF UPLINK BEAMFORMING IN WIRELESS LOCAL AREA NETWORK SYSTEM

Simplified Explanation

The abstract describes an operating method for wireless communication between two devices in a WLAN. The method involves receiving a data unit from the second device, which includes a payload containing a trigger frame. The first device then prepares an uplink beamforming matrix based on a value in the preamble of the data unit. The first device uses this matrix to beamform the data unit and transmits it back to the second device based on a value in the trigger frame.

Original Abstract Submitted

an operating method of a first device communicating with a second device in a wireless local area network (wlan), includes: receiving, from the second device, a physical layer protocol data unit (ppdu) including a payload that includes a trigger frame; preparing an uplink beamforming matrix based on a value of an uplink beamforming-related first sub-field included in a preamble of the ppdu; beamforming, according to the uplink beamforming matrix, the ppdu; and transmitting the beamformed ppdu to the second device based on a value of an uplink beamforming-related second sub-field included in the trigger frame.
